Delving into Beyond Visible Spectrum: Investigating Infrared and Ultraviolet

The human eye can only perceive a limited range of electromagnetic radiation, known as the visible spectrum. However, extending this range lie two fascinating realms: infrared and ultraviolet. Infrared light, with its longer wavelengths, carries heat, allowing us to feel the sun's rays even on a cloudy day. Fiber Optic Communication: Connecting the World with Light

Fiber optic communication utilizes light pulses to transmit data over vast distances. These pulses travel through thin strands of glass or plastic called optical fibers, carrying information at incredible speeds. The advantages of fiber optic communication are numerous. Firstly, it offers significantly higher bandwidth compared to traditional copper wire systems, allowing for faster data transfer rates and a smoother online experience. Secondly, fiber optic cables are immune to electromagnetic interference, ensuring signal integrity and reliability even in harsh environments. Lastly, they have a longer lifespan than copper cables, reducing maintenance costs and downtime.
